Bitcoin Surges 12% in 24 Hours: Analysis Reveals What's Next for BTC After Massive Price Jump
Bitcoin is showing an impressive recovery, with a 12% surge in a single day, pushing the price back toward $70K after weeks of consolidation below a descending trendline. This short-term structural improvement suggests the market may be on the verge of breaking a critical resistance level. Bitcoin is now approaching an important resistance cluster that could determine if this is the start of a genuine trend reversal or just a temporary corrective move. Analysts are closely monitoring the $70K level as a decisive zone, with trading volume and momentum strength being crucial factors to confirm the continuation of BTC's upward trajectory.

Fake Crypto AML Scams Targeting User Wallets
The fraudsters use fake interfaces that mimic compliance checking tools, asking users to authorize transactions under the guise of a "security verification." This practice poses a significant risk to cryptocurrency investors, especially at a time when global regulations are becoming stricter. Users need to be extremely vigilant and always verify the authenticity of tools before any approval.
